ARTP Council members, ARTP Executive Board members and all members of ARTP committees and working groups will be invited to declare their interests at the start of the meeting of each group.
If you believe you have a received or real conflict of interest you should:
• declare the interest at the earliest opportunity
• withdraw from discussions and decisions relating to the conflict
ARTP should take special care to ensure that minutes or other documents relating to the item presenting a conflict are appropriately redacted for the person facing the conflict. A balance needs to be made to ensure that the person still receives sufficient information about the activities of ARTP generally without disclosing such sensitive information that could place the individual in an untenable position.
If you fail to declare an interest that is known to the ARTP Secretary and/or ARTP Chair, the ARTP Secretary or ARTP Chair will declare that interest.
In the event of the ARTP Council, Executive Board, committee or working group having to decide on a question in which an ARTP Council member, ARTP Executive Board member, ARTP committee or working group member has an interest, all decisions will be made by vote. A quorum must be present for the discussions and decision; interested parties may not be counted when deciding whether the meeting is quorate. Interested ARTP Council members, Executive Board members, committee or working group members may not vote on matters affecting their own interests.
All decisions under a conflict of interest will be recorded and reported in the minutes of the meeting. The report will include:
• the nature and extent of the conflict
• an outline of the discussion
• actions taken to manage the conflict
Where an ARTP Council member benefits from the decision, this will be reported in the annual report and accounts.
All payments and benefits in kind to ARTP Council members will be reported in the charities accounts and annual report, with amounts for each trustee listed for the year in question.
Where an ARTP Council member, ARTP Executive Board member or member of ARTP a committees or working group is connected to a party involved in the supply of a service or product to the charity, this information will be fully disclosed in the annual report and accounts.
Independent external moderation will be used where conflicts cannot be resolved through the usual procedures.
